#0c7329 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c7329 is composed of 4.7% red, 45.1%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 24.9%. #0c7329 color hex could be obtained by blending #18e652 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#0c7329 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c7329 has RGB values of R:12, G:115,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 815913.

Shades and Tints of #0c7329
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010803 is the darkest color, while #f6f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c7329
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d423e is the less saturated color, while #027d25 is the most saturated one.
